About this role

Business Analytics Intern São Paulo Ready to take your first steps in the mobile gaming industry? We're looking for a Business Analytics Intern to join our User Acquisition / Marketing team at Wildlife Studios. User Acquisition (UA) is about bringing players into our worlds - and doing it smarter every day. We are a highly analytical, data-driven team that uses technology and creativity to find and engage the right players across global platforms like Meta, Google, and TikTok. If you're curious, enjoy working with numbers, and want to learn in a fast-paced environment, this is where gaming and growth collide. What you'll do - Performance Analysis: Monitor and analyze user acquisition campaigns, helping identify optimization opportunities. - Creative Testing: Support the design and evaluation of A/B tests, exploring different approaches to engage audiences. - Project Prioritization: Develop your ability to use good judgment to solve problems and drive impact in a dynamic environment. - Cross-functional Collaboration: Work alongside different teams, supporting the communication of results and alignment with key stakeholders. What you'll need - Currently pursuing a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Computer Science, Business, or a related field, with expected graduation between July 2027 and December 2027 . - Strong analytical mindset, organizational skills, and clear communication. - Interest or foundational knowledge in programming - SQL, R, or Python is a plus.
